Integrating TQM and Lean 5.0 Enhances Manufacturing Agility

Combining Total Quality Management (TQM) with Lean Thinking 5.0 principles creates a more agile and adaptive manufacturing system capable of navigating Industry 4.0 transformations.

Academic Publication · 2024

01

Key Findings

  • 01An integrated approach of TQM and Lean Thinking 5.0 is essential for modern industrial competitiveness.
  • 02Lean 4.0, Lean Six Sigma, QFD, and advanced problem-solving are critical components of this integrated approach.
  • 03Case studies demonstrate the practical application and benefits of TQM principles.

Method & Evidence

AimHow can the integration of Total Quality Management and Lean Thinking 5.0 principles improve the agility and competitiveness of manufacturing and service industries in the context of Industry 4.0?
MethodLiterature Review and Case Study Analysis
ProcedureThe research synthesizes theories and methods from Total Quality Management and Lean Thinking, specifically focusing on Lean 5.0 concepts. It examines various tools and strategies including Lean 4.0, Lean Six Sigma, problem-solving techniques, statistical and managerial tools, Quality Function Deployment (QFD), risk management, and customer analysis. The study is further informed by in-depth case studies illustrating TQM principles in practice.

Paragraph starter

The integration of Total Quality Management (TQM) and Lean Thinking 5.0 offers a robust framework for enhancing manufacturing agility and competitiveness within the context of Industry 4.0. By combining TQM's focus on customer satisfaction and continuous improvement with Lean's principles of waste reduction and process optimization, businesses can develop more adaptive and responsive production systems. Tools such as Lean 4.0, Lean Six Sigma, and Quality Function Deployment (QFD) are central to this integrated approach, enabling organizations to effectively manage quality, reduce inefficiencies, and meet evolving market demands.
